Biopharma industries represent a crucial sector within the broader pharmaceutical industry, focusing on the development and production of biopharmaceuticals. These products are derived from living organisms, such as proteins, nucleic acids, or cells, and are playing an increasingly important role in the treatment of various diseases. The Rise of biopharma industries
Over the past few decades, biopharma industries have emerged as a dominant force in the global pharmaceutical market. Rapid advancements in biotechnology, genomics, and personalized medicine have paved the way for the development of a wide range of biopharmaceutical products, including monoclonal antibodies, recombinant proteins, vaccines, and gene therapies. These products offer targeted and personalized treatment options for patients with complex and chronic conditions, revolutionizing the way diseases are treated and managed.
The growing prevalence of chronic diseases, such as cancer, diabetes, and autoimmune disorders, has created a strong demand for innovative and effective treatment options, driving the growth of the biopharma industry. In addition, increasing investments in research and development, favorable regulatory environment, and expanding healthcare infrastructure in emerging markets are further fueling the expansion of biopharma industries worldwide.
Key Players in the Biopharma Industry
The biopharma industry is characterized by a diverse ecosystem of companies, ranging from small start-ups to multinational corporations. Some of the key players in the biopharma industry include big pharma companies like Roche, Merck, and Novartis, as well as biotech firms such as Amgen, Biogen, and Gilead Sciences. These companies are at the forefront of innovation, developing cutting-edge biopharmaceutical products and therapies that are transforming the landscape of modern medicine.
In addition to traditional pharmaceutical companies, contract research organizations (CROs) and contract manufacturing organizations (CMOs) play a critical role in the biopharma industry, providing a range of services from drug discovery and development to manufacturing and distribution. These partners help biopharma companies accelerate the drug development process, reduce costs, and improve operational efficiency, enabling faster access to life-saving treatments for patients in need.
Challenges and Opportunities in biopharma industries
While the biopharma industry is experiencing rapid growth and innovation, it also faces several challenges and obstacles that must be addressed to ensure sustainable success. One of the key challenges is the high cost and complexity of biopharmaceutical development, which requires significant investments in research, manufacturing, and regulatory compliance. In addition, the growing competition and market saturation are putting pressure on companies to differentiate themselves by developing novel and high-value products.
Furthermore, the regulatory landscape for biopharmaceuticals is constantly evolving, with increasing scrutiny and stringent requirements from regulatory authorities around the world. Companies must navigate complex regulations and guidelines to ensure compliance and secure approval for their products, which can be a time-consuming and costly process.
